How it feels

This film tells the true story of playwright Joe Orton and his lover Kenneth Halliwell. It follows their volatile relationship and Orton's rise to fame in the 1960s.

What happens

Prick Up Your Ears is a 1987 British film, directed by Stephen Frears, about the playwright Joe Orton and his lover Kenneth Halliwell. The screenplay was written by Alan Bennett, based on the 1978 biography by John Lahr. The film stars Gary Oldman as Orton, Alfred Molina as Halliwell, Wallace Shawn as Lahr, and Vanessa Redgrave as Peggy Ramsay.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
